À propos de cet audio

Have you ever been bullied? Betrayed by a friend? Critical of who you see in the mirror every day? Born with a clubfoot and enduring intense physical and emotional pain because of it, international speaker, TEDx speaker, and anti-bullying author Chloe Howard will help you overcome the pain and struggles in your own life, coming alongside you as a friend on your journey to live happy and free.

You are enough. You are a daughter of God. And no matter how hard life gets, you don’t have to do it alone. In Stand Beautiful, Chloe shares her story of being bullied about a birth defect as a freshman and how it helped her not only overcome self-doubt, it also gave her the courage to rise up and speak out to help others.

Ultimately, Stand Beautiful will inspire young people ages 12 and up to:

  • Be brave and find beauty within diversity
  • Speak up against injustice and stand up for what is right
  • Redefine beauty as more than what the eye can see
  • Stop being self-destructive and choose self-empowerment

Fueled by a powerful encounter with Bono from the band U2, Stand Beautiful features:

  • A “Lessons Learned” section that highlights valuable lessons every teen should know
  • An “Interview with Chloe” section that gives readers details about her favorite iTunes playlist, books on her bookshelf, and much more
  • The encouragement and hope teens need to accept their unique selves, just as they are
